I have a 4gee Wi-Fi mini router which I use for camping etc. I have a 120GB data sim in which lasts 12 months (started last month). I have come to Spain, as I have for the last 3 years with the same data sim, and mini router, and this year it is not working. I can see the Wi-Fi is working, but it says ‘no internet connection’.

I smdknt think there has been any changes to the eu rules since last year, why is it not working? What can I do? Any help I read is only for PAYG subscription etc, and when I look it tells me I don’t need to buy any more data as I have loads anyway…… help!

@hy9 : Roaming on PAYG has changed since June '23 & there are now charges for PAYG SIMs to use their pack allowances in EU. Pre-paid data SIMs, not having a pack, are for use in UK only.
